Optimizing Bankroll Management
Effective bankroll management is the cornerstone of the ‘monopoly big baller’ strategy. A large bankroll is critical to withstand inevitable losing streaks and to capitalize on winning opportunities when they arise. The size of the bankroll should be proportionate to the stakes being played, and players should avoid risking more than a small percentage of their total funds on any single bet. A common rule of thumb is to risk no more than 1-2% of your bankroll on any given wager but, the ‘monopoly big baller’ is not afraid to engage with higher stake percentage but with the clear understanding of what he or she is risking.
Diversification can also be helpful. Spreading funds across multiple games and different bet sizes can reduce overall risk. Additionally, it’s vital to have a clear exit strategy – knowing when to walk away from a game or the casino altogether, whether on a winning or losing streak. Disciplined bankroll management is not about avoiding losses entirely; it’s about minimizing their impact and ensuring longevity in the game.
